本篇文章讲述了如何让岱山安卓软件更专业化。在现代科技的发展过程中,移动应用成为了现代人们不可或缺的一部分。而作为一款App,如何更专业化,是开发人员需要把握的核心问题。针对这个问题,我们从界面设计、代码优化、权限管理、多平台兼容以及统计分析五个方面进行了探讨。
1. 界面设计
在界面设计上,人们往往更看重互动性和可视性。对于岱山安卓软件来说,漂亮且易用的图形化界面是吸引用户的关键。因此,开发人员应该在设计时考虑以下几点:
(1)简约的布局设计。过于繁杂的布局会让用户感到混乱,影响使用效果。
(2)颜色搭配。如果颜色搭配不当,可能会让用户产生不适感。
(3)对话框和按钮的设计。对话框和按钮是人们使用软件最为频繁的交互元素,设计时需考虑大小、颜色、字体等多方面的细节。
2. 代码优化
代码优化是保证软件运行稳定的核心问题,而这也是制作高品质应用的关键。岱山安卓软件在代码优化方面有以下几点建议:
(1)优化代码结构。对于代码结构混乱、冗余的代码,我们应该优化它。简洁规范的代码将使程序运行更加高效。
(2)异常处理机制。在应用中不可避免会出现各种异常,我们需要为这些异常添加相应的处理机制,以保证运行稳定。
(3)减少内存和CPU占用。内存和CPU是影响应用性能的关键因素,优化代码将有助于减少内存和CPU占用。
3. 权限管理
对于岱山安卓软件来说,权限管理是保证用户隐私安全的关键。我们需要准确把握各组件使用的权限,在应用中正确设置权限。这样可以防止恶意程序获取用户隐私,保护用户的隐私信息。
4. 多平台兼容
随着技术发展,安卓操作系统已经有了多个版本和各种设备尺寸。这就要求我们的应用在不同平台上能够完美兼容。针对这个问题,建议开发人员保证应用的屏幕适配性、API兼容性、资源兼容性、系统版本兼容性。
5. 统计分析
统计分析可以帮助开发人员深入了解用户的需求并提高应用的用户体验。开发人员应该在应用中加入统计和分析功能,收集应用每个部分的点击量、使用时间、用户地理位置等统计信息,对于数据的分析可以帮助开发人员了解用户需求,改进软件。
总结:
通过以上开发建议,开发人员可以快速提高岱山安卓软件的专业化水平。在软件设计与制作方面,每个细节都需要重视,方能做到更好的用户体验和高品质的软件制作。未来,我们相信岱山安卓软件将会越来越完善,为用户提供更好的服务和使用体验。
岱山安卓软件高级制作,是一项能够让应用程序更专业化的技能。本文将从不同的角度介绍岱山安卓软件高级制作的相关知识,包括软件安全性、软件测试、用户体验、设计等方面。通过学习本文,大家可以在安卓软件制作中更加专业化。
1. 提升软件安全性
在软件制作中,安全性是一个非常重要的问题。岱山安卓软件高级制作中,需要关注安全性的方面有很多,如代码的安全、数据的安全、网络连接的安全等。要想让应用程序更专业化,在保证安全的前提下,应该追求更高的性能优化和界面设计。针对安全问题,可以采用以下几种方法:
(1)使用加密技术
加密技术是一种有效的保障软件安全性的方法。在代码和数据方面,可以采用加密技术来避免信息泄露,增加软件的安全性。同时,应该尽可能地避免硬编码和明文,防止攻击者通过反编译等方式获取敏感信息。
(2)防范代码注入
在软件开发过程中,如果不注意代码注入攻击,则可能面临严重的安全威胁。岱山安卓软件高级制作中,可以采取一些技术手段来防范代码注入攻击,如限制用户输入字符的长度、检测用户输入的字符是否合法等。
(3)使用可靠的网络通信协议
在网络连接方面,要使用可靠的网络通信协议,如HTTPS协议,而不是不安全的HTTP协议,以提高数据的安全性。
2. 如何进行软件测试
软件测试是保证应用程序质量的重要手段。岱山安卓软件高级制作中,进行软件测试非常关键,下面介绍几种测试方法:
(1)黑盒测试
黑盒测试是指测试人员不需要了解软件的内部实现细节,只需要针对功能需求点进行测试。通过对软件功能进行多次测试,可以快速发现和修复软件中的缺陷。
(2)白盒测试
白盒测试是基于软件源代码的测试方法。测试人员需要了解软件的内部实现细节,针对代码进行测试。通过白盒测试,可以发现软件的逻辑错误、循环错误、输入验证错误等问题。
(3)回归测试
在软件升级更新或迭代过程中,可能会出现自己修复的BUG重新出现,此时需要进行回归测试。回归测试是针对发布的软件版本进行全面的功能和性能测试,以确保软件发布的质量稳定。
3. 用户体验设计
在岱山安卓软件高级制作中,用户体验设计也是非常重要的一环。用户体验设计是围绕用户需求,提供更好的界面交互效果,让用户更好地使用软件。用户体验设计的核心是以用户为中心,下面介绍几种常见的用户体验设计方法:
(1)人机交互设计
人机交互设计是指设计一个可以与用户使用者进行互动的界面。界面设计需要考虑用户的操作习惯和心理需求,尽量简单明了,易于操作。
(2)信息架构设计
信息架构设计将用户需求转化为软件结构,通过组合和分类等方式展现信息,使用户容易找到所需要的信息。在信息架构设计中,要注意清晰的注解、易于分类、标签的设置等。
4. 应用程序界面设计
应用程序界面设计是将设计元素整合形成的界面模板。在岱山安卓软件高级制作中,应用程序的界面设计非常重要,除了要考虑到用户体验和操作习惯,还要注重设计元素的合理性和美观性。
(1)颜色搭配
软件的颜色搭配是非常关键的,要选择合适的颜色搭配,既要符合软件的主题和情感目标,还要能够符合用户的使用习惯。
(2)字体设计
字体在应用程序界面设计中也是非常关键的一部分,要选择好看又不影响阅读的字体。
5. 结尾段落
在岱山安卓软件高级制作中,软件安全性是最重要的方面。要保障软件的安全性,可以通过加密技术、防范代码注入、使用可靠的网络通信协议等方式。同时,在软件制作过程中,要注重软件测试、用户体验设计、应用程序界面设计等方面,以保证应用程序的质量和专业性。希望大家在学习岱山安卓软件高级制作时,能够掌握以上几个方面所需的技能。